Beikoku Shorin - Ryu was founded by Tim Evans and Robert White in September 2004 in order to carry on the tradition of founder Chosin Chibana. It is the goal of this association to provide it's members with the tools to carry on our proud lineage in the spirit of education, personal growth, and tradition.

Kyoshi Tim Evans 7th degree black belt and Renshi Robert White 6th degree black belt in Okinawan Shorin -Ryu Karate have been training together since Oct. 1973. Through the years these two men have gone down many paths in their search for learning and understanding the true interpretations and applications of the Shorin - Ryu method of karate and kobudo. Now Beikoku Shorin - Ryu President, Tim Evans and Vice-President, Robert White hope to share their discoveries with all who are willing to learn.
